Bozeman, Montana · EIN 830331707. Its Form 990-PF says giving is not restricted to organizations picked in advance, which is how a private foundation files that it accepts unsolicited requests. It paid $2.8M across 113 grants in 2023, a median of $22K each.

The 15 largest of the 113 grants paid in 2023, with the purpose the foundation wrote for each.
| # | Recipient | State | Amount | Purpose as filed |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Ogden Weber Applied Technology Coll | UT | $100,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 2 | Earthjustice | CA | $75,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 3 | Paws of Jackson Hole | WY | $70,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 4 | American Prairie Reserve | MT | $50,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 5 | Family Promise of Gallatin County | MT | $50,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 6 | Habitat for Humanity of East Jeffer | WA | $50,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 7 | Jefferson Land Trust | WA | $50,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 8 | Northwest Maritime Center | WA | $50,000 | General Fund |
| 9 | Sagebrush Steppe Land Trust | ID | $50,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 10 | Snake River Animal Shelter | ID | $50,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 11 | Teton Regional Land Trust | ID | $50,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 12 | The Friendship Center | MD | $50,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 13 | The Trust for Public Land | MT | $45,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 14 | Friends of the Teton River | ID | $40,000 | GENERAL FUND |
| 15 | National Wildlife Federation | VA | $40,000 | GENERAL FUND |
